M. Ward’s sophomore album, following up Duet for Guitars #2 – and what a wonderful album it is.
My copy is a 20th anniversary reissue on vinyl from Jealous Butcher Records which sounds amazing. Future Farmer did release a vinyl edition in 2009 but this one is remastered by Adam Gonsalves at Telegraph Mastering.
Liner notes added in January 2021 from Adam Selzer:
With the exception of “Ella,” “Archangel Tale” & “Pirate Radio Sermon” this album was recorded at my old studio, Type Foundry Recording . . . a ramshackle, two-room space in Southeast Portland, sandwiched between a Buddhist community center and a cash register repair shop.
